Форум программистов, компьютерный форум CyberForum.ru

реестр -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Найти наибольшую из площадей треугольников, вершины которых находятся в заданных точках http://www.cyberforum.ru/cpp-beginners/thread237412.html
Здравствуйте! Написать программу на C++: Даны координаты 4-х точек x1,y1, x2,y2, x3,y3, x4,y4. найти наибольшую из площадей треугольников, вершины которых находятся в заданных точках. (Формула Герона, состоит из двух чисел).
C++ Определить общее количество операций В общем, я протупил создав эту http://www.cyberforum.ru/cpp-beginners/thread236913.html тему! Нужно было сразу написать условие задачи: Количество операций Определить общее количество операций сложения (+), вычитания (-) и умножения (*) в заданном арифметическом выражении. Технические условия Входные данные В единственной строке задано арифметическое выражение, не... http://www.cyberforum.ru/cpp-beginners/thread237409.html
C++ Структуры, объединения и определяемые пользователем типы. Массивы структур
Здравтсвуйте! Помогите, пожалуйста, разобраться с одной задачкой! Условие следующее: Разработать программу обработки данных железнодорожного расписания. Известно расписание поездов, проходящих через станцию: номер поез¬да, назначение (откуда куда, например, Москва—Омск), часы и мину¬ты прибытия, часы и минуты отправления. Значения часов и минут це¬лые, положительные числа; число часов не...
C++ Сортировка.
Доброе время суток. Разработать алгоритм сортировки методом простых вставок на основе сортировки таблицы адресов. Должны сортироваться записи типа record Key: integer; Info: <любой другой тип>; … end; Сортировку проводить по ключевому полю Key.
C++ Массив с русс буквами. http://www.cyberforum.ru/cpp-beginners/thread237358.html
Пишу программу в линуксе. int main() { char slova = { 'в',' д',' й',' х',' ч',' я',' т',' к',' д',' ж' }; return 0; }
C++ Написать программу, которая выводит содержимое массива наоборот //1. Написать программу, которая выводит содержимое массива наоборот. // Пример: массив 23 11 6 превращается в 6 23 11. #include <iostream> using namespace std; void main(){ const int size=5; int array ={0}; for(int i=0;i<size;i++) { cout << i+1 << ")->"; подробнее

Показать сообщение отдельно
Skip
3 / 3 / 0
Регистрация: 11.11.2010
Сообщений: 38
03.02.2011, 14:27  [ТС]     реестр
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
#include "stdafx.h"
#include <iostream>
#include <windows.h>
#include <conio.h>
using namespace std;
 
int main()
{
    TCHAR *val=_T("C:\\myprogramm.exe");
    DWORD size=_tcslen(val);
    
    HKEY hKey;
 
        if (RegOpenKeyEx(HKEY_LOCAL_MACHINE, TEXT("SOFTWARE\\Microsoft\\Windows\\CurrentVersion\\Run"), 0, KEY_ALL_ACCESS, &hKey)!=ERROR_SUCCESS)
                cout<<"Error #1\n";
        else
        {
        if (RegSetValueEx(hKey, TEXT("Mydream"), NULL , REG_SZ, (BYTE*)val,2*size)==ERROR_SUCCESS)
        {
            cout<<"dobavlena v reestr \n";
        }
        else
            cout<<"Error #2 \n";
        }
   
        RegCloseKey(hKey);
 
        getch();
}
в итоге , только такой код заработал
а как научить программу , что бы она себя находила в системе и добавляла в реестр
 
Текущее время: 16:40.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ru